Output 20544ddce129f4db11959cb2f1a70e399f40cf7a4384e925335ed6afb8256624:3

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c76c0b9fc128b748b99aead1bf8d1e6e6ad398f OP_EQUAL
address
32pvHwLAS5SSXfrY78iBy9ZmkfPsE7Mvxz
transaction
20544ddce129f4db11959cb2f1a70e399f40cf7a4384e925335ed6afb8256624
spent
true